Ashley Underwood QC
LLB Law (LSE) 1975
Barrister of Gray’s Inn 1976
Ashley Underwood is a tenant at Landmark Chambers. He took silk
in 2001. Prior to that he was on the Supplementary
Panel of Junior Counsel to the
Crown.
Ashley has two principal areas of work: chancery/ commercial and
public law. His public law work is mainly for central and local government. He
has acted for the local authorities in many of the major housing cases. He is
joint editor of Hill & Redman Public Sector Tenancies. He has acted for the
Secretary of State for the Home Department in a large number of important human
rights cases. In addition he is on the Attorney
General’s list of Special
Advocates.
From 2004, he was Leading Counsel to the Robert
Hamill Inquiry, a public
inquiry forming part of the
Northern Ireland peace process. He is
currently Counsel to the Azelle Rodney Inquiry.
